If you have ever heard of the phrase “Don’t go chasing waterfalls” then it was quoted from James martin who created the rapid application development (RAD) model in 1991. This model was created due to the shortcomings of the Waterfall methodology which was dominant at that time. So, what is RAD? What is rapid application development? From the name, you can deduce that it concerns building an application rapidly. But that is not all there is to RAD. unlike the Waterfall model, it focuses on user feedback to create working solutions over strick planning and execution. With RAD there is…
